Snake Stelleo
About
Snake Stelleo is a nonbinary virtual YouTuber and streamer from the United States, working independently through Snake Stelleo Productions. He’s also a classically trained composer and music producer, with model work by Aileen Rose.

Lore
Snake was once human until 2020, when an alien android named Pato, hailing from a distant planet in the Milky Way galaxy known as Automachia, made a visit to Earth. Initially, Pato planned to conquer the planet and harvest its resources for his kind. However, when he discovered video games, it led to him becoming distracted from his mission and befriending Snake. Over time, Snake gained Pato's trust, and Pato offered to convert him into an Automachion, an offer he gladly accepted. In 2022, Pato returned to his home planet, believing Earth's resource deposits to no longer be worthwhile. This left Snake as Earth's sole representative of the Automachions.
As an Automachion, Snake possesses godlike powers, capable of enduring some of the most extreme conditions in the universe and causing destruction to almost anything he sees as a target. He has shattered planets, collapsed stars, and disbanded solar systems, but he only chooses to do so to those whose inhabitants dare to threaten the Earth.
Appearance
Snake's "V3.6" avatar has long black hair with a blue and cyan highlight, a dual stranded ahoge that forms a heart shape, glasses with blue tinted lenses, and matching blue eyes. He wears a cropped top with branding from his music project and a casual black jacket with neon blue and green markings. His jacket features a bass clef on the left shoulder, and a treble clef on the right.
When he becomes angry, a large pair of fangs (sometimes referred to as "teefies") becomes prominently visible.

Trivia
- Snake has been producing and releasing electronic music as St4bility since 27 November 2014. He occasionally uses Snake Stelleo Ch to showcase and promote St4bility releases, and frequently uses St4bility songs as background music in his videos. ** Snake produces music using Reason, a digital audio workstation by Reason Studios that is known for the way it emulates a studio synthesizer rack. ** Snake also uses his skills as St4bility to produce the beats for his lyrical songs as Thesnakerox and Snake Stelleo. *Snake is a classically trained composer, with a Bachelor Of Arts In Music from San Francisco State University. He also has experience singing as a Baritone and Tenor. * Snake's kami oshi is Projekt Melody. Other VTubers he admires include Ironmouse and DokiBird. * Snake's favorite game of all time is Minecraft; even though he's played it less often as time goes on, he credits it as the game that got him invested in PC gaming * After completing Mondstadt's Archon Quests in Genshin Impact, Snake has titled almost every subsequent Genshin stream as some variation of "Venti my beloved". * Snake's original alias of "Thesnakerox" stems from his and his younger brother's shared Minecraft username in 2011. However, as they got older and went on separate paths, Snake gradually took over the Thesnakerox name and brand.

Content
Snake identifies as a variety content creator, his uploads consisting of, in his words, "whatever I feel like doing week by week." Content topics include but are not limited to gaming, lock picking, song covers, foam dart blasters, and music analyses.
2021
On 23 June, Snake uploaded his first video in which he used a VTuber avatar, dubbed "Snake V1".
On 20 July, Snake uploaded a video in which he used an updated version of his avatar, dubbed "Snake V2". This version of the avatar featured blue tinted glasses and a black T Shirt with branding from his music project St4bility on it, and continued to be used until 2022.
2022
On 30 January, Snake uploaded his first video in which he used an avatar commissioned from Aileen Rose, dubbed "Snake V3". The V3 avatar went through a series of smaller changes, made by Snake himself over the months, up until V3.4.
2023
On 4 April, Snake uploaded his first video showing a development version of his V3.5 avatar. Notable changes include a blue streak in his hair and an ahoge with two longer strands that form a heart shape. This video would also be his first showcase of the songs he makes as St4bility on the Thesnakerox channel.
2024
On 12 October, Snake released his first lyrical song--a Twitch diss track titled "Simp King." In the song, he addresses numerous grievances with Twitch, including the mishandled implementation of the Knock feature, the platform's covering up of Dr Disrespect's inappropriate conduct, and the longstanding allegations of the platform actively marginalizing VTubers in favor of "IRL" streamers.
In November, Snake revealed his full name of Snake Stelleo, and also released "Flatline"--a song commemorating the decade anniversary of the St4bility project and commenting on the state of music and entertainment.
2025
In October, Snake debuted the Snake's Stories podcast--a podcast that serves both as an open diary and a means of putting more content out to fight YouTube's "algorithmic garbage".
In December, Snake graduated from San Francisco State University with a Bachelor Of Arts In Music, per the foreword for his piece Commencement, "Experientia Docet".
2026
In February, following persistent struggles with the job market culminating in 220 applications that have led nowhere, Snake officially began a push for content creation as a full-time pursuit.
